2. 2026-2027 Meal Prices
Speaker(s):
Jen Variale
Rationale:
Please read the attached memo. Annually the Board needs to set meal prices for students and staff (breakfast and lunch). We are required to raise the prices .10. There is current legislation which would provide free breakfast for all students, regardless of income. If that occurs, we would eliminate the charge.

3. 2026-2027 Tuition Rates
Speaker(s):
Christine Carver
Rationale:
Annually, the Board sets tuition rates for non-resident students. The Board has always adopted those rates at an increase commensurate with the budget increase.
Since I am asked every year, we have one student this year (BHS) who is not a resident and pays full tuition. It also sets the rates for staff members children attend BPS based on district policy. We currently have 30 staff member's children that attend (K-12).
